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Chaine de caractère

  • Initiateur de la discussion Initiateur de la discussion clement22
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

C

clement22

Guest
Bonjour à tous,

Mon petit problème est le suivant,

J'ai deux cellules différentes avec à l'ntérieur, par exemple,
pour c2 un code vendeur BAVIVE8888888 et pour C3 une plaque d'immatriculation
3342 YG 72 (anciennes plaques) et BB-675-AT (nouvelles).

J'aimerai donc savoir s'il est possible de récupérer les 10 premiers chiffres du code vendeur et les 3 derniers chiffres de l'immatriculation.

Un exemple : BAVIVE8888342 ou BAVIVE8888675 (tout dépend de la plaque)

J'ai tenté avec la fonction gauche mais elle prend tous les caratères (3342 au lieu de 342 ou BB-675 ou lieu de 675)
Je ne sais donc pas coment faire...

Merci d'avance pour votre aide.

Cordialement.
 
Dernière modification par un modérateur:
Re : Chaine de caractère

Oui c'est vrai mais je me suis mal exprimé.

Ce n'est que les chiffres qui m'intéressent; donc soit les 3 derniers chiffres de 3342 ( 342) ou les 3 chiffres de BB-675-AT soit 675.

Je ne sais pas si c'est plus clair ?
 
Re : Chaine de caractère

Bonjour Clément, Pierrot, Masterdisco, Gillus,

Une formule valable pour les plaques de type 1234 FF 78, 123 FF 78, BB-675-AT

Code:
=GAUCHE(C2;10) & SI(ESTNUM(CNUM(DROITE(GAUCHE(C3;4);1)));SI(ESTNUM(CNUM(DROITE(C3;1)));DROITE(GAUCHE(C3;4);3);DROITE(GAUCHE(C3;6);3));GAUCHE(C3;3))

Cordialement

KD

edit : marche aussi pour 123 DEF 775, la solution de Masterdisco marche aussi pour les 4 types de plaques
 
Dernière édition:
Re : Chaine de caractère

Je vous resolicite afin de savoir s'il est possible d'ajouter des espaces lors d'une concaténation.
Je m'explique, exemple j'ai 3 cellules c2="Très" c3="bonne" c4="journée";

Je souhaite donc dans une autre cellule avoir Très bonne journée mai j'obtient avec la fonction concatener Trèsbonnejournée.


Merci d'avance pour votre aide.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

L
Réponses
6
Affichages
3 K
M
Réponses
13
Affichages
9 K
M
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…